OLY - 1956 - ATHLETICS - MARATHON
OLY - 1956 - ATHLETICS - MARATHONFrench champion Alain Mimoun crosses victoriously the finish line of the Olympics marathon event, on November 22, 1956 at the Olympic stadium in Melbourne. Most medaled French athlete, Mimoun has during his career captured 32 French champion titles, middle distance, long distance, cross and marathon between 1947 and 1966. He won four Olympics medals : gold, marathon1956, silver, 5,000 m in 1952, 10,000 in 1948 and 1952. World cross champion in 1949, 52, 54 and 56. French selection recordman (85). AFP
